Output 80b0723e70d2939a46c261447d515d9e62d8da2ec0e892f7d9cfc2b03140f54a:3

value
141188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b295780280d5b95039d5db8fc2af7b941ae0c412 OP_EQUAL
address
3HyHFxov2HcBREzkDjJreFNYV95ugsvaGt
transaction
80b0723e70d2939a46c261447d515d9e62d8da2ec0e892f7d9cfc2b03140f54a
confirmations
188713
spent
true